Are you curious why someone would choose to buy an old watch while there are better watches with today’s technology with more innovative features? There are various reasons why a person will go for a vintage watch instead of a smartwatch. 

Foremost, buying a vintage watch allows you to own something unique. When you get your hands on an original piece, it will be unlikely to find someone else wearing the same piece. 

Secondly, a vintage watch means getting value for your money. These watches are of high quality and with hand-crafted techniques rare in modern watches. Lastly, there are highly durable!
